  1. cognomen

    • IPA[käɡˈnōmən]

    美式

    • n.
      a third personal name given to an ancient Roman citizen, typically passed down from father to son, for example Marcus Tullius Cicero.;a name or nickname.
    • noun: cognomen, plural noun: cognomens
